NEW LIGHTS AT SYDNEY. It has been definitely decided by the. Sydney Horbour Trust Commissioners to erect two rooro leading lights in the harbour, one at Bonnclong Point, tho other at Kirribilli. For some time past shipmasters liavo been oonrplaining of tho danger existing in tho vicinity or tho two •points on a foggy morning, and. it is a result of this agitation that the. decision has been arrived at. Tho -working has so far progressed that it is hoped the lights—they arc to be of high power elec-tric-will be switched, on in the course, of a. few days.
